BOTTOM OF THE EIGHTH INNING

 

Herrera in to pitch for Cincinnati

Baker, pinch hitting for Fontenot, homered to left center field

K Hill struck out swinging

Johnson walked

Fukudome sacrificed, 1-3, Johnson to second

Burton in to pitch for Cincinnati

Theriot singled to center field , Johnson scored

Theriot stole second base

D Lee homered to center field , Theriot scored

A Ramirez doubled to left field

Bradley grounded out to the pitcher, 1-3

 

4 runs 4 hits 0 errors 1 men left on base

 

                1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9              R  H  E
Cincinnati      0 3 0 0 0 0 0 0                3  7  0
CUBS            1 1 1 0 0 1 0 4                8 14  1

 

Home runs:

Cincinnati: Harang (1)

CUBS: Fontenot (8), Ramirez (6), Baker (1), D Lee (19)

 

Cincinnati     IP  H  R ER BB  K HR PIT
Harang        6.0  9  4  4  1  6  2 119
Masset        1.0  1  0  0  1  1  0  16
Herrera       0.7  1  2  2  1  1  1  13
Burton        0.3  3  2  2  0  0  1  10

 

CUBS           IP  H  R ER BB  K HR PIT
Wells         6.0  7  3  3  1  5  1  88
Heilman       1.0  0  0  0  0  1  0  12
Marmol        1.0  0  0  0  0  1  0  13
